The Winter Solstice occurred on Sunday morning (21st Dec 08), druids, pagans and tourists alike flocked to Stonehenge in Wiltshire to celebrate. For some people it is a religious festival, for others it is pagan tradition of celebrating the shortest day of the year. Nearly 2,000 people, some dressed in cloaks and robes, saw the sunrise at the prehistoric site.
